aboutsummaryrefslogtreecommitdiff
path: root/cast/common/public/message_port.h
diff options
context:
space:
mode:
Diffstat (limited to 'cast/common/public/message_port.h')
-rw-r--r--cast/common/public/message_port.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/cast/common/public/message_port.h b/cast/common/public/message_port.h
index 23094740..91eabcd1 100644
--- a/cast/common/public/message_port.h
+++ b/cast/common/public/message_port.h
@@ -20,11 +20,13 @@ class MessagePort {
public:
class Client {
public:
- virtual ~Client() = default;
virtual void OnMessage(const std::string& source_sender_id,
const std::string& message_namespace,
const std::string& message) = 0;
virtual void OnError(Error error) = 0;
+
+ protected:
+ virtual ~Client() = default;
};
virtual ~MessagePort() = default;